You will begin your tour at the Nanjing Massacre Memorial Hall, a solemn site dedicated to honoring the memory of the victims of the 1937 Nanjing Massacre. Located in the heart of Nanjing, this memorial stands as a powerful symbol of the immense tragedy that unfolded during the Japanese invasion. The hall is divided into several exhibition areas, each filled with photographs, personal testimonies, and historical artifacts that vividly capture the suffering of the innocent civilians and soldiers who perished. One of the most moving sections is the Hall of Silence, where visitors can reflect on the profound loss and pay their respects. As you explore the exhibits, your guide will provide in-depth historical context and share poignant stories, helping you understand the broader impact of this atrocity on both China and the world. The visit offers a deep, reflective experience, paying tribute to those lost, while also emphasizing the importance of peace, remembrance, and the resilience of the Chinese people in the face of such unimaginable tragedy.

After lunch, you will visit the Presidential Palace, an iconic site that has played a significant role in Chinese history. Once the official residence of the President of the Republic of China, this grand complex now serves as a museum showcasing Nanjing's historical and political significance. The Presidential Palace is a blend of traditional Chinese and Western architectural styles, reflecting the fusion of cultures during the late Qing Dynasty and early Republic period. As you stroll through the expansive grounds, you’ll encounter well-preserved buildings, including the main presidential office, the reception hall, and the former imperial gardens, which provide a serene contrast to the historical events that took place here. Your guide will provide insights into the history of the palace, explaining its role during the tumultuous period of the Republic, its significance in modern Chinese history, and its importance in shaping the political landscape of China. The site offers a fascinating glimpse into the political and cultural shifts that influenced the country in the early 20th century.

Finally, we will head to Yuejiang Tower, a majestic historical site perched atop Lion Mountain with commanding views of the Yangtze River. Originally commissioned by Emperor Zhu Yuanzhang, the founder of the Ming Dynasty, the tower symbolizes military triumph and imperial authority. Though the original structure was never completed in his time, the current tower faithfully reflects traditional Ming architecture, with multi-tiered eaves, vibrant red pillars, and ornate details that convey the grandeur of the era. As you ascend the tower, you’ll enjoy sweeping views of the river, the city skyline, and the surrounding hills—making it one of Nanjing’s top scenic spots. Inside, exhibitions highlight Nanjing’s role during the early Ming period, featuring calligraphy, historical accounts, and cultural relics. Your guide will explain the strategic and symbolic importance of this site, offering insight into how Yuejiang Tower embodies the fusion of military power and cultural ambition in imperial China. This visit is not only a visual highlight, but also a meaningful journey into the city’s rich political and architectural heritage.

In the morning, our tour guide will pick you up at your hotel lobby, and your tour will begin with a visit to Niushou Mountain (Ox Mountain), one of the most renowned cultural and scenic spots in Nanjing. Niushou Mountain is celebrated for its rich history, breathtaking natural beauty, and deep connection to Buddhist culture. The mountain is home to the Niushou Mountain Cultural Park and the impressive Niushou Mountain Buddhist Complex, which together create a serene environment filled with temples, statues, and traditional architecture that evoke a sense of peace and tranquility. The highlight of the visit is the grand Niushou Mountain Buddha, a massive statue that symbolizes spiritual enlightenment, standing proudly as a symbol of faith and devotion. From the top of the mountain, you’ll be rewarded with panoramic views of lush forests, peaceful valleys, and the surrounding landscape, offering a serene escape from the city. As you explore, your guide will provide fascinating insights into the history and cultural significance of Niushou Mountain, sharing stories of its Buddhist heritage, its role in Chinese spiritual life, and the enduring importance of the site, ensuring a truly immersive and enriching experience.

Next, we will visit the Confucius Temple (Fuzimiao), one of Nanjing’s most renowned cultural landmarks, located along the scenic Qinhuai River. Originally built in the Song Dynasty, the temple honors Confucius, the great philosopher whose teachings have shaped Chinese ethics, education, and governance for over two millennia. As you walk through the temple complex, you will be immersed in an atmosphere of tradition and reverence, surrounded by elegant courtyards, stone carvings, and red-walled halls that reflect classical Chinese architecture.

At the heart of the complex lies the Dacheng Hall, or “Hall of Great Achievement,” the most important structure within the temple. This grand hall houses a large statue of Confucius and is adorned with plaques and calligraphy reflecting his core teachings. Your guide will share the historical and philosophical background of Confucianism, helping you understand how this ancient belief system continues to influence modern Chinese society. Beyond the temple, the surrounding Fuzimiao district offers a vibrant local experience, with traditional shops, lantern-lit alleys, and riverside charm.

Traditional Pear Syrup Candy Making Experience
Nanjing’s pear syrup candy, known as Li Gao Tang, is a time-honored delicacy with a rich heritage. Crafted through a unique process passed down over generations, this sweet treat is beloved for its smooth, flavorful taste. In this hands-on experience, you’ll discover the traditional methods behind making pear syrup candy and get the chance to make your own batch with guidance from an expert candy maker.

Cloisonné Enamel Crafting Experience
Cloisonné enamel is an ancient and sophisticated art form, known for its vibrant colors and intricate designs. In this hands-on workshop, you will learn how metal wires are shaped to create compartments (cloisons) and then filled with colorful enamel, a process that requires great precision and patience. You will leave with your own cloisonné piece as a memento of your experience.

Shadow Puppet Crafting Experience
Shadow puppetry is an ancient Chinese art that brings characters to life through the use of cut-out puppets. In this experience, you will learn the process of creating shadow puppets, from carving and painting the figures to attaching them to rods for performance. You’ll be able to create your own shadow puppet and gain insight into the history and technique behind this traditional art form.
